    A few of you might be aware of, or remember our previous 488 Novitec build. That was one of the most awesome cars we have built and experienced. While it was a blast, we knew the spider was around the corner, so it found a new home with one of our good clients. We love to keep things moving here at TAG and keep you all up with fresh content, latest product updates, and fresh ideas for you all. After the 488 coupe, we entered into our 2017 R8 V10+, and then into our McLaren 570S…. And now, back to what we love the most…. The Ferrari world…..

    In the summer of 2016, we went ahead and did European Delivery on our 2017 R8 V10+ and one of our stops we knew was going to be the Ferrari Factory for an Atelier appointment to spec our Spider. That was quite the experience. With quite a few options selected, and a very unique build in order, we were ready and eager for the vehicle to arrive.

    Fast forward to January 2017 - Our good friends and dealer, Ferrari of Newport Beach gave us a call to inform us that we had to make a choice. Ferrari had changed Modus (their ordering system) and all Atelier and Tailor Made Cars were delayed indefinitely. We had to make a choice, A) Wait it out or B) change the spec to something a bit more normal. After quite a bit of time on the configurator, we went ahead with a somewhat “Standard” order an no Extra Campanario options. And to be honest, it came out amazing.

    The car was spec’d in Rosso Scuderia exterior with just the right amount of carbon bits on the exterior and interior to tie it all in. On the inside we went with the Carbon Goldrake Seat with Red Alcantara center and Red Leather Accents. The end result was just stunning. Here is the complete list of options

    Being that we went a little extreme on our 488 coupe, for our second go around, we wanted something that would appeal more to the masses, and enjoy the car. Nothing too crazy (the whole office chuckles). With that in mind, the theme of this build was “CLEAN and ENJOYABLE”

    We started with HRE P207 wheels finished in Satin Black. These have been some of our favorites this year from HRE. We went with a 20x9 and 21x13 fitment and installed the OEM Red Ferrari caps with an adaptor. Pirelli P-Zero (PZ4) was our tire of choice. We loved our last 488 lowered, and this was no different. We installed the tried and true Novitec Springs to adjust the altitude to our liking. Why not more Novitec? It works flawlessly with the factory Noselift and rides fantastic.


    We had to install our favorite Novitec Exhaust System. The Non-Valved system gives the exhaust a more aggressive and higher pitched sound that we wanted. Having the roof down, and that exhaust system just sounds amazing. Tons of extra burbles and pops, and also an added turbo whine when coming back down to idle. We finished off the performance upgrades with the Novitec N-Tronic ECU Upgrade. This was a plug & play unit that gave us 756 HP when flipped into RACE Mode. Gave the Twin Turbo V8 a very nice bump without making the car un-drivable or unreliable.

    To add final touches, we installed SOUND front skid plates, then we had the entire front end wrapped in XPEL Clear Bra.
